Bhitari
Bhitari is a village located in Bah tehsil of Agra district in Uttar Pradesh, India. It is situated 25km away from sub-district headquarter Bah (tehsildar office) and 60km away from district headquarter Agra. As per 2009 stats, Balai is the gram panchayat of Bhitari village.

About Bhitari
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Bhitari is 125218. The village spans a total geographical area of 352 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 283113. Pinahat is nearest town to Bhitari village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 23km away.

Population of Bhitari
Below is a concise population overview of Bhitari as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 451 | 226 | 225 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 72 | 33 | 39 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 100 | 51 | 49 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| N/A | N/A | N/A |
Literate Population | 308 | 174 | 134 |
Illiterate Population | 143 | 52 | 91 |
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Bhitari village:
- The total population of Bhitari village is around 451, including approximately 226 males and 225 females, with a sex ratio of 995 females per 1,000 males.
- There are about 72 children aged 0–6 years in Bhitari village, reflecting the young population in the village.
- Bhitari village has 100 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C).
- The literacy rate of Bhitari village is about 68.29%, with male literacy at 76.99% and female literacy at 59.56%.
- There are around 79 households in Bhitari village.
Connectivity of Bhitari
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Bhitari. As per the 2011 stats, Bhitari had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
